Steps:
- 1. Place first 5 ingredients in a food processor. Process until finely minced about 1 minute. Pour into saucepan, bring to boil add teaspoon of corn starch turn heat down and simmer. Heat the ham by following directions on the package. In the last half hour of cooking, brush the prepared glaze over entire ham and return to oven. Serve remaining glaze on the side.
